Von On-Premise zur Cloud: Strategien für eine reibungslose Migration

Von On-Premise zur Cloud: Strategien für eine reibungslose Migration

Cloud-Migration Meistern: Ihr Komplettguide für eine erfolgreiche digitale Transformation

Abstract

Entdecken Sie, wie Sie Ihre IT-Infrastruktur erfolgreich in die Cloud migrieren. Von der Planung bis zur Umsetzung - dieser Guide begleitet Sie Schritt für Schritt auf Ihrem Weg in die digitale Zukunft.
  • #Cloud-Migration
  • #IT-Infrastruktur
  • #Digitalisierung
  • #Cloud-Strategie
  • #Cloud-Services
  • #Cloud-Sicherheit
  • #Hybrid Cloud
  • #Public Cloud
  • #Private Cloud
  • #Multi-Cloud

Cloud-Migration: Warum, Was und Wie - Alles, was Sie wissen müssen

Herzlich willkommen zu unserem umfassenden Guide über Cloud-Migration! Wenn Sie darüber nachdenken, Ihre IT-Infrastruktur in die Cloud zu verlagern, sind Sie hier genau richtig. In diesem Artikel erfahren Sie alles Wichtige über die Herausforderungen und Chancen einer Cloud-Migration. Wir beleuchten, was Sie migrieren sollten, wie Sie dabei vorgehen und warum sich der Aufwand lohnt. Also, schnallen Sie sich an - es wird eine spannende Reise!

Was bedeutet Cloud-Migration eigentlich?

Bevor wir in die Tiefe gehen, lassen Sie uns kurz klären, wovon wir überhaupt sprechen. Cloud-Migration bezeichnet den Prozess, bei dem Daten, Anwendungen und IT-Prozesse von lokalen Systemen in die Cloud verlagert werden. Klingt einfach, oder? Nun, in der Praxis ist es oft komplexer, als man denkt. Aber keine Sorge, wir nehmen Sie an die Hand!

Was genau migrieren Sie in die Cloud?

Wenn Sie an Cloud-Migration denken, fallen Ihnen wahrscheinlich zuerst Ihre Anwendungen und Daten ein. Aber es gibt noch so viel mehr zu beachten! Lassen Sie uns einen genaueren Blick darauf werfen:

1. Die offensichtlichen Kandidaten: Anwendungen und Systeme

Ja, Ihre Geschäftsanwendungen sind definitiv ein wichtiger Teil der Migration. Ob es sich um Ihr Inventarmanagementsystem, Ihre Point-of-Sale-Anwendung oder andere wichtige Software handelt - all das muss in die Cloud.

2. Die Grundlagen: Compute und Speicher

Hier geht es um die Basis Ihrer IT-Infrastruktur:

  • Compute-Ressourcen: Virtuelle Maschinen, Container, Anwendungsserver - alles, was Rechenleistung bereitstellt.
  • Speichersysteme: Von einfachen Dateifreigaben bis hin zu komplexen Archivsystemen.

3. Das Rückgrat Ihrer IT: Netzwerk und Sicherheit

Vergessen Sie nicht Ihre Netzwerkkomponenten:

  • Lastverteiler
  • Firewalls
  • VPNs

Dies ist eine großartige Gelegenheit, Ihre Netzwerk- und Sicherheitsarchitektur zu überdenken und zu optimieren!

4. Das Herz Ihrer Daten: Datenbanken und Analysetools

Ihre Datenbanken, Data Warehouses und Analysesysteme sind oft die schwersten Brocken bei einer Migration. Aber keine Sorge, die meisten Cloud-Anbieter bieten spezielle Tools für die Datenmigration an.

5. Ihre Geschäftskritischen Systeme

Denken Sie an Ihre ERP-Systeme, CRM-Lösungen und branchenspezifische Software. Diese Systeme sind oft komplex und erfordern besondere Aufmerksamkeit bei der Migration.

6. Die Verbindungsstücke: Middleware und APIs

Vergessen Sie nicht Ihre Enterprise Service Busse, Datenextraktionstools und API-Gateways. Diese Komponenten sind oft das Bindeglied zwischen verschiedenen Systemen und daher kritisch für den Erfolg Ihrer Migration.

7. Identitäts- und Zugriffsmanagement

Ihre Identitätsmanagement-Systeme und Sicherheitsdienste müssen ebenfalls in die Cloud. Das ist eine gute Gelegenheit, Ihre Sicherheitsarchitektur zu modernisieren!

8. Management und Monitoring

Auch Ihre Managementtools wie Konfigurationsmanagement, Provisionierungswerkzeuge und Monitoring-Systeme müssen migriert werden. Viele On-Premises-Anbieter bieten inzwischen Cloud-fähige Versionen ihrer Tools an.

9. Entwicklungsumgebungen

Denken Sie auch an Ihre Entwickler! Source-Control-Systeme, Artefakt-Repositories und Testumgebungen - all das muss in die Cloud.

Wie gehen Sie die Migration an?

Okay, jetzt wissen Sie, was alles migriert werden muss. Aber wie packen Sie das konkret an? Hier sind einige Schlüsselstrategien:

1. Bauen Sie zuerst die Grundlagen auf

Bevor Sie wild drauflos migrieren, legen Sie eine solide Basis in der Cloud. Dazu gehören:

  • Eine durchdachte Mandantenstruktur
  • Ein zentrales Identitätsmanagement
  • Eine persistente Verbindung zwischen Ihrem Unternehmensnetzwerk und der Cloud

2. Wählen Sie den richtigen Migrationsansatz

Es gibt nicht den einen richtigen Weg. Je nach Anwendung und Anforderungen können Sie verschiedene Ansätze wählen:

  • Lift and Shift: Einfach kopieren und in der Cloud laufen lassen.
  • Lift and Optimize: Kleine Optimierungen während der Migration.
  • Move and Improve: Erst migrieren, dann verbessern.
  • Improve and Move: Erst verbessern, dann migrieren.
  • Rebuild: Komplett neu für die Cloud entwickeln.
  • Replace: Durch eine SaaS-Lösung ersetzen.

3. Entscheiden Sie über Cloud-Services

Welche Cloud-Services wollen Sie nutzen? Bleiben Sie bei selbst verwalteter Software oder setzen Sie auf verwaltete Cloud-Dienste? Diese Entscheidung hat Auswirkungen auf Kosten, Wartung und Bereitstellung.

4. Fokussieren Sie sich auf Wertschöpfung

Migrieren Sie nicht einfach Infrastrukturschichten, sondern ganze Anwendungen und Systeme. So erzielen Sie schneller einen Mehrwert.

5. Passen Sie Ihre Prozesse an

Ihre On-Premises-Prozesse passen wahrscheinlich nicht 1:1 in die Cloud. Überdenken Sie, wie Sie budgetieren, provisionieren und Änderungen genehmigen.

6. Setzen Sie auf Automatisierung

Automatisierung ist der Schlüssel zum Erfolg in der Cloud. Von der Bereitstellung von Ressourcen bis hin zur Skalierung - automatisieren Sie, was Sie können!

7. Investieren Sie in Schulungen

Cloud-Computing ist ein Paradigmenwechsel. Investieren Sie in die Weiterbildung Ihrer Mitarbeiter - von Entwicklern über Architekten bis hin zu Projektmanagern.

Warum sollten Sie überhaupt in die Cloud migrieren?

Sie haben sich bereits für die Cloud entschieden, aber es ist wichtig, die Gründe klar zu kommunizieren - besonders gegenüber Nicht-IT-Stakeholdern. Hier sind einige überzeugende Argumente:

1. Schnellere Wertschöpfung

Die Cloud ermöglicht es Teams, schneller Wert für Kunden zu liefern. Neue Features? Kein Problem!

2. Verbesserte Ausfallsicherheit

Mit der richtigen Architektur können Sie in der Cloud eine Verfügbarkeit erreichen, die On-Premises kaum möglich wäre.

3. Kostentransparenz

In der Cloud sehen Sie genau, was welche Workload kostet. Das ermöglicht fundierte Geschäftsentscheidungen.

4. Zugang zu Innovationen

Cloud-Anbieter entwickeln ständig neue Services. Nutzen Sie diese, um innovative Kundenerlebnisse zu schaffen!

Fazit: Ihre Cloud-Reise beginnt jetzt

Eine Cloud-Migration ist eine komplexe, aber lohnende Aufgabe. Sie erfordert sorgfältige Planung, die richtige Strategie und kontinuierliches Lernen. Aber die Vorteile - von erhöhter Agilität bis hin zu besserer Kostenkontrolle - machen den Aufwand mehr als wett.

Denken Sie daran: Eine erfolgreiche Migration ist mehr als nur ein IT-Projekt. Es ist eine Chance, Ihr gesamtes Unternehmen zu transformieren und für die digitale Zukunft fit zu machen. Also, worauf warten Sie noch? Ihre Cloud-Reise beginnt jetzt!

Häufig gestellte Fragen (FAQ)

1. Wie lange dauert eine typische Cloud-Migration?

Die Dauer einer Cloud-Migration kann stark variieren und hängt von Faktoren wie der Größe Ihres Unternehmens, der Komplexität Ihrer IT-Landschaft und dem gewählten Migrationsansatz ab. Kleinere Projekte können in wenigen Monaten abgeschlossen sein, während umfangreiche Migrationen durchaus 1-2 Jahre in Anspruch nehmen können. Es ist wichtig, realistisch zu planen und die Migration als kontinuierlichen Prozess zu betrachten.

2. Welche Sicherheitsaspekte muss ich bei einer Cloud-Migration beachten?

Sicherheit ist bei einer Cloud-Migration von zentraler Bedeutung. Achten Sie besonders auf:

  • Datenverschlüsselung (sowohl bei der Übertragung als auch im Ruhezustand)
  • Identitäts- und Zugriffsmanagement
  • Netzwerksicherheit und Segmentierung
  • Compliance mit relevanten Datenschutzbestimmungen
  • Regelmäßige Sicherheitsaudits und Penetrationstests

Viele Cloud-Anbieter bieten robuste Sicherheitsfeatures, aber die Verantwortung für die richtige Konfiguration und Nutzung liegt bei Ihnen.

3. Wie kann ich die Kosten meiner Cloud-Migration kontrollieren?

Kostenkontrolle ist ein wichtiger Aspekt jeder Cloud-Migration. Hier einige Tipps:

  • Führen Sie vor der Migration eine gründliche Bestandsaufnahme durch, um unnötige Migrationen zu vermeiden.
  • Nutzen Sie Cloud-native Dienste, um Ihre Workloads zu optimieren.
  • Implementieren Sie ein robustes Tagging-System für Ressourcen, um Kosten genau zuordnen zu können.
  • Nutzen Sie die Kostenmanagement-Tools Ihres Cloud-Anbieters.
  • Schulen Sie Ihre Teams in Cloud-Kostenoptimierung.
  • Überprüfen und optimieren Sie Ihre Cloud-Nutzung regelmäßig.

Bedenken Sie: Die Cloud kann Kosten senken, aber nur wenn Sie sie richtig nutzen und managen.

  • IT Operation
  • Infrastruktur
  • Digitalisierung

Weitere Blog-Artikel

Moderne KI-Anwendungen entwickeln: Von Prompting bis zu Agenten

Entdecken Sie die drei wichtigsten Implementierungsmuster für KI-Anwendungen mit Large Language Models: Basic Prompting, RAG und Agenten. Ein praxisnaher Einblick für Webentwickler.

mehr erfahren

DevOps Revolution: So optimieren Sie Ihre Software-Entwicklung

Entdecken Sie, wie DevOps-Praktiken Ihre Softwareentwicklung revolutionieren können. Von CI/CD bis zur Qualitätssicherung - hier erfahren Sie alles Wichtige für erfolgreiche DevOps-Integration.

mehr erfahren

GraphRAG: Intelligente Datenvernetzung für Unternehmen

Erfahren Sie, wie GraphRAG die Verarbeitung und Vernetzung von Unternehmensinformationen revolutioniert und präzisere, schnellere Entscheidungen ermöglicht.

mehr erfahren

Svelte 5: Die komplette Einführung für JavaScript-Entwickler

Eine umfassende Einführung in Svelte 5: Lernen Sie die Grundlagen, neuen Features und Best Practices des beliebten Frontend-Frameworks.

mehr erfahren

Softwareentwicklung im Wandel: Wie KI und neue Technologien die Branche verändern

Ein tiefgehender Einblick in die Transformation der Softwareentwicklung durch KI, moderne Entwicklungspraktiken und neue Technologien. Erfahren Sie, wie sich die Rolle von Entwicklern wandelt und welche Kompetenzen in Zukunft gefragt sind.

mehr erfahren

Large Language Models (LLMs): Von GPT bis PaLM - Die Revolution der KI-Sprachmodelle

Ein umfassender Einblick in die Welt der Large Language Models (LLMs): Von der Architektur über bekannte Modelle wie GPT-4 und PaLM bis hin zu aktuellen Entwicklungen und Zukunftstrends.

mehr erfahren

Von Monolith zu Microservices: Ein Architektur-Wegweiser

Entdecken Sie die wichtigsten Fallstricke bei der Implementierung von Microservices und lernen Sie, wie Sie einen verteilten Monolithen vermeiden. Praxisnahe Tipps für erfolgreiche Microservices-Architekturen.

mehr erfahren

Moderne Web- & App-Entwicklung: Ihr Weg in die digitale Zukunft

Erfahren Sie, wie Sie die größten Herausforderungen der digitalen Transformation meistern und Ihr Unternehmen zukunftssicher aufstellen können.

mehr erfahren

Die Zukunft der Softwarebranche: Von KI bis Quantum Computing

Eine Analyse der wichtigsten Trends und Technologien, die die Software-Entwicklung in den kommenden Jahren prägen werden - von Cloud Computing über künstliche Intelligenz bis hin zu Quantum Computing.

mehr erfahren

Cybersecurity: Die wichtigsten Trends und Bedrohungen für 2025 im Überblick

Erfahren Sie, welche Cybersecurity-Trends uns 2025 und darüber hinaus erwarten. Von KI-gesteuerten Bedrohungen bis hin zu Quantum-Safe-Kryptografie - dieser Artikel beleuchtet die wichtigsten Entwicklungen in der digitalen Sicherheit.

mehr erfahren

Zukunftssichere IT-Infrastruktur: Strategien für kleine und mittlere Unternehmen

Erfahren Sie, wie kleine und mittlere Unternehmen die Herausforderungen der digitalen Transformation erfolgreich bewältigen können. Von Cloud-Migration bis IT-Sicherheit - hier finden Sie praxisnahe Lösungen für Ihre IT-Modernisierung.

mehr erfahren

Tech-Trends 2025: KI, Robotik und die digitale Transformation der Zukunft

Ein umfassender Überblick über die wichtigsten Technologie-Trends 2025: Von künstlicher Intelligenz und Robotik bis hin zu Kryptowährungen und Cloud Computing. Erfahren Sie, welche Entwicklungen unsere digitale Zukunft prägen werden.

mehr erfahren

JavaScript Pakete sicher aktualisieren: Methoden und Strategien

Lernen Sie die effektivsten Methoden und Tools kennen, um JavaScript-Pakete sicher und effizient zu aktualisieren. Von npm audit bis yarn autoclean - dieser Artikel zeigt Ihnen, wie Sie Ihre Abhängigkeiten professionell verwalten.

mehr erfahren

Skalierbare Webanwendungen entwickeln: Von Microservices bis Cloud-Computing

Erfahren Sie, wie Sie skalierbare Webanwendungen mit modernen Technologien und bewährten Methoden entwickeln. Von Microservices über Datenbankmanagement bis hin zu Cloud-native Lösungen.

mehr erfahren

SOLID Prinzipien in der Praxis: So entwickelst du bessere Software

Eine praxisnahe Einführung in die SOLID-Prinzipien der Softwareentwicklung. Lernen Sie, wie Sie diese wichtigen Designprinzipien in Ihren Projekten effektiv einsetzen können.

mehr erfahren

Digital Consulting: Erfolgsstrategien für die digitale Transformation

Erfahren Sie, wie Digital Consulting Unternehmen dabei hilft, technologische Innovationen erfolgreich in Geschäftswert umzuwandeln. Von Strategieentwicklung bis zur praktischen Implementierung - dieser Artikel zeigt, wie moderne Unternehmensberatung funktioniert.

mehr erfahren

Python Paketverwaltung leicht gemacht: Die besten Tools und Methoden

Entdecke die besten Tools und Methoden für eine effiziente Paketverwaltung in Python-Projekten.

mehr erfahren

Moderne Webentwicklung: Workshop-Strategien für bessere Resultate

Entdecken Sie, wie der strategische Einsatz von Workshops in der Webentwicklung Kommunikation verbessert, Entwicklungszyklen beschleunigt und Projektresultate optimiert. Ein umfassender Leitfaden für Projektmanager und Entwicklungsteams.

mehr erfahren

Skalierbare Next.js-Architekturen: Von Monolith zu Micro-Frontends

Ein umfassender Leitfaden zu Enterprise-Architektur-Patterns und Best Practices für Next.js-Anwendungen. Erfahren Sie, wie Sie skalierbare, wartbare und sichere Webanwendungen mit Next.js entwickeln.

mehr erfahren

React 19: Revolution der Web-Entwicklung mit neuen Features und Optimierungen

Eine umfassende Analyse der wichtigsten Neuerungen in React 19: Vom experimentellen React Compiler über stabilisierte Server Components bis hin zu optimierten Entwickler-Workflows.

mehr erfahren

Was dürfen wir für Sie tun?

So sind wir zu erreichen: